BR Bridal Skincare Routine for Glowing Skin
One Year Out
- Find a dermatologist. We recommend finding a dermatologist at least a year in advance. Finding a professional will help you beyond measure. They will access your skin to see the current state and devise a suitable solution for you. You’ll have a whole year to work on your skin, so you don’t have any regrets on your big day. Moreover, if any treatments require a substantial healing period, you can get them done in advance.
- Manage your stress levels. Stress is the most prevalent cause of last-minute breakouts. All the stress hormones will play havoc on your skin. Hence, it is better to control your stress in advance. Try meditating, practice breathing techniques, and journaling. It is not skincare-related but hands down one of the best things you can do for your skin.
- Implement double cleansing. Experts agree that double cleansing is one of the best ways to achieve clear skin. If you haven’t implemented this one already, implement it now. Get yourself a good old oil cleanser and a face wash that suits your skin type.
Nine Months Out
- Retinol and hyaluronic acid. Add Retinol & Hyaluronic Acid to your routine when you are nine months out. Retinol will make your skin look youthful, and hyaluronic acid will add a much-needed boost of hydration. Wear SPF during the day while using retinol; otherwise, it can irritate your skin. Always apply hyaluronic acid on slightly damp skin to get the maximum results.
- Get regular facials. If you haven’t been too keen on facials, it is time to get them done regularly. You can get acne facials, hydra facials, facials for calming down redness, or any other facial that suits your skin concerns. Talk to your dermatologist about which type of facials will suit your skin best.
Six Months Out
- Drink more water. No amount of skincare you do on the outside can replace what you put inside your body. If you are not a fan of drinking water, it is time to change that habit. Aim at consuming 8 to 10 glasses of water a day, and limit caffeinated beverages to see your skin glow from within.
- Reduce processed food intake. Your diet needs to include lots of fruits, vegetables, healthy fats and carbs, and proteins. Reduce the intake of processed foods. Try to eat home-cooked meals as often as you can. When you focus on eating healthy, your skin will slowly transform.
Two Months Out
- Professional treatments. Get your last professional treatment, whether it be a chemical peel or laser skin resurfacing, before two months. It will give your skin the time to heal and recover so you look your best on your big day. In some cases, the side effects linger for much longer. Hence, it is recommended to cut off the treatments before the two-month marker.
- Keep it simple. This is when you don’t want to experiment too much with your skin. Stick to the skincare products that have been working for you. Do not try the next best mask and that trending peel on the market. It is time to maintain your skin, not try anything new.
One Week Out
- Massage your face. Get your hands on a good old facial roller. It will help drain the excess fluid from your face and make it look less puffy. It will boost blood circulation and make your skin look smoother and firmer on your wedding day. A bonus tip is to place your roller in the fridge to make the experience way more relaxing.
